I’ll Be Speaking at SQL Saturday #49 in Orlando

imageWe’ve worked with the organizers of SQL Saturday #49 to be able to bring you a full day line up of PowerShell but it get’s even better.  In addition to myself and the usual Florida crew of PowerShell-for-SQL speakers, as luck would have it Microsoft Scripting Guy Ed Wilson and the Scripting Wife just happened to be on vacation in Orlando that very weekend!  Open-mouthed smile 

I’ll be doing my intermediate session on PowerShell to give those scripts one last run through before choosing what to show off at the Summit.  If you’ve seen my beginner session in Tampa, Jacksonville, or Miami this one picks up and builds on that one.  Not much has changed for the intermediate session since Columbia but it is a long car ride down there and I’m not driving so we’ll see if I come up with something new.  I hope to see you there.
